Dj blub: "A legend in his own time, George Lewis was without doubt the most famous and fearless solicitor England has every produced." He was adviser to Edward VII (concerning his mistresses), Gilbert & Sullivan, Lillie Langtry, Oscar Wilde, Whistler, Thomas Hardy, Henry James, others. Law in Victorian England.
